WebProvide your pet carpet python with a basking point inside the cage. You may use a heat pad or ceramic heat globe in the cage. While the basking spot must have a temperature of 88 to 93°F, the general temperature of the cage must be maintained between 75 to 80°F. At any stage, temperature of the cage should not drop below 75°F. WebApr 2, 2024 · The ideal humidity range for ball pythons in captivity is around 55%. When the snake is going into shed, you can increase the level to around 65%. This will help your ball python separate the old outer layer of skin. Most ball python morphs that are commercially available in the pet trade are the result of captive breeding; however, albinos are ... WebAs a species Ball Pythons are hardy and healthy. But, they do have some health issues that can happen due to improper care and bad husbandry. Common health issues include: mites, respiratory infections, and mouth rot. Most of these issues are easily avoided with the proper care. Respiratory issues are a common issue in all ball pythons.
